In 2025, Repair Right’s focus is on All American Five radios. Participants will have the opportunity to repair their own devices while learning the intricacies of repairing and restoring these historical electronic gems with knowledgeable instructors. This sign up is specifically for Phase I, the entry level course. Each session will begin with a lecture and end with a lab in the Raymer Workshop. Participants have two date/time options to choose from: · March 5 & 12 (Wednesdays): 9:30 a.m. – 12:00 p.m. · March 8 & 15 (Saturdays): 9:30 a.m. – 12:00 p.m. The lecture portions of Phase I will cover the following topics: Basic radio safety Skill assessment Radio assessment (how to identify easy or difficult items to repair or replace) Understanding how a radio works Exploring the evolution of radio Introduction of basic troubleshooting techniques In the lab portions of Phase I, students will work on: Identifying safety hazards Tube testing Checking for functionality offline Evaluating voltage readings Performing dim bulb tests Replacing electrolytic capacitors Potentially replacing other capacitors By the end of this course, students will acquire a fundamental understanding of radio components and troubleshooting techniques. They will have hands-on experience in replacing electrolytic capacitors and potentially other capacitors. Additionally, students will gain proficiency in basic troubleshooting methods related to radio repair. For this course, students are required to have a basic proficiency in soldering, reading a schematic, and identifying components. If these skills are not already possessed, we strongly encourage participants to enroll in a Pavek Museum Crash Course before registering for this specific program.
